    Hi Madam Bonzai why my beauganvilles some years dont flower? Thanks.

    • @MadamBonsai2023
      @MadamBonsai2023  9 місяців тому

      Hi Kelvin
      If you see it grow so much green but no flowers it’s to much nitrogen
      If too much shade it will beautiful grow but rarely bloom
      Too
      When was the last time you give it repot and cut back?
